Job Summary/Basic Functions
The School of Engineering, Aviation, Construction, and Technology Chair will…
● Provide dynamic collegial visionary leadership and direction to a School with a dedicated faculty and staff.
● Coordinate short-term and long-term planning with faculty and staff.
● Facilitate faculty and staff development, program assessment, curriculum review and development, and oversight of teaching and laboratories.
● Operate within a multidisciplinary teaching, research and service environment in such a way as to enhance excellence in these areas.
● Manage the administrative, fiscal, and instructional resources of the School.
● Ensure effective representation and communication between the School faculty, staff, students, dean and other administrative officers of the University.
● Recruit and support talented faculty and staff to fulfill the School's mission of providing high quality instructional programs with practical applications.
● Coordinate with faculty in the development and renewal of academic curricula to account for changes in the industry.
● Effectively distribute faculty time between teaching, service and scholarship.
● Enhance existing student recruitment and retention strategies and actively plan and enlist new and creative strategies with School faculty.
● Develop and maintain professional relationships with alumni and stakeholders.
● Serve as a strong advocate for faculty, staff and students to ensure that funds are used equitably for compensation, professional development, projects, equipment, and travel.
● Lead School institutional effectiveness reporting for short- and long-term University strategic planning.
● Answer concerns of administration, faculty, staff, students and the public in a timely and appropriate manner.
● Teach undergraduate/graduate courses in area of expertise.
● Evaluate faculty and support staff.
Minimum Qualifications
Education: Hold an earned doctorate in a field related to the School's programs.
Experience: Meet the requirements for appointment with tenure at the rank of professor or associate professor. Demonstrate the ability to effectively manage budget, personnel issues and conduct strategic planning.
